Halifax Health and WDSC Present “Medical Matters”

Halifax Health has partnered with WDSC Channel 15 to present "Medical Matters." This program provides an educational forum for the community to learn and ask questions about pertinent healthcare topics.

This week's program will feature Richard J. Duma, MD, Director of Infectious Diseases at Halifax Health and Sanford Zelnick, MD, Medical Director of the Volusia County Health Department. These experts will provide an informative update on H1N1 (swine) flu.

The 30-minute show airs Thursday beginning at 7:30 pm and will feature a call-in opportunity for viewers at the end of the show.

Halifax Health
Building on an 80-year history of exceptional medical diagnostic and treatment services in East Central Florida, Halifax Health is ranked among the top 5% of all hospitals in the nation for clinical outcomes. Within an expanding network of specialized healthcare services at Halifax Health is a tertiary hospital, community hospital, psychiatric services, a cancer treatment center with four outreach locations, the area's largest hospice, and Florida's largest Emergency Department (opening 2009). Halifax Health offers the area's only Level II Trauma Center, Comprehensive Stroke Center, Neonatal and Pediatric Intensive Care Units, Pediatric Emergency Department, Child and Adolescent Behavioral Services, and Neurosurgical Services. Widely recognized for its outstanding medical staff and leading-edge technology, Halifax Health consistently receives top statewide and national ratings for its specialties, including orthopedics, spinal surgery, stroke services, vascular services, and cardiology. In 2008, the organization was also ranked #2 among the Top 100 Companies for Working Families (Orlando Sentinel). Halifax Health is a legislatively-chartered taxing organization, governed by a Board of Commissioners appointed by the Governor of Florida. For more information, visit halifaxhealth.org.
